59 * The client program to connect to para_server.
61 * \param argc Usual argument count.
62 * \param argv Usual argument vector.
64 * It registers two tasks: The client task that communicates with para_server
65 * and the supervisor task that minitors whether the client task intends to
66 * read from stdin or write to stdout.
68 * Once it has been determined whether the client command corresponds to a
69 * stdin command (addmood, addimg, ..), either the stdin task or the stdout
70 * task is set up to replace the supervisor task.
72 * \return EXIT_SUCCESS or EXIT_FAILURE
74 * \sa client_open(), stdin.c, stdout.c, para_client(1), para_server(1)
